Output de4583680fe80c635b09565f4de8b8b8f23288e01dfb022f4029aaf937a2a0de:0

value
6110300
script pubkey
OP_0 OP_PUSHBYTES_20 d46c345c575ad2867e373776263399c530057739
address
bc1q63krghzhttfgvl3hxamzvvuec5cq2aeeu86vhp
transaction
de4583680fe80c635b09565f4de8b8b8f23288e01dfb022f4029aaf937a2a0de
confirmations
318420
spent
true